							| @ -0,0 +1,106 @@ | ||||
| // Copyright (c) 2022 Shivaram Lingamneni | ||||
| // released under the MIT license | ||||
| 
 | ||||
| package bunt | ||||
| 
 | ||||
| import ( | ||||
| 	"fmt" | ||||
| 	"strings" | ||||
| 	"time" | ||||
| 
 | ||||
| 	"github.com/tidwall/buntdb" | ||||
| 
 | ||||
| 	"github.com/ergochat/ergo/irc/datastore" | ||||
| 	"github.com/ergochat/ergo/irc/logger" | ||||
| 	"github.com/ergochat/ergo/irc/utils" | ||||
| ) | ||||
| 
 | ||||
| // BuntKey yields a string key corresponding to a (table, UUID) pair. | ||||
| // Ideally this would not be public, but some of the migration code | ||||
| // needs it. | ||||
| func BuntKey(table datastore.Table, uuid utils.UUID) string { | ||||
| 	return fmt.Sprintf("%x %s", table, uuid.String()) | ||||
| } | ||||
| 
 | ||||
| // buntdbDatastore implements datastore.Datastore using a buntdb. | ||||
| type buntdbDatastore struct { | ||||
| 	db     *buntdb.DB | ||||
| 	logger *logger.Manager | ||||
| } | ||||
| 
 | ||||
| // NewBuntdbDatastore returns a datastore.Datastore backed by buntdb. | ||||
| func NewBuntdbDatastore(db *buntdb.DB, logger *logger.Manager) datastore.Datastore { | ||||
| 	return &buntdbDatastore{ | ||||
| 		db:     db, | ||||
| 		logger: logger, | ||||
| 	} | ||||
| } | ||||
| 
 | ||||
| func (b *buntdbDatastore) Backoff() time.Duration { | ||||
| 	return 0 | ||||
| } | ||||
| 
 | ||||
| func (b *buntdbDatastore) GetAll(table datastore.Table) (result []datastore.KV, err error) { | ||||
| 	tablePrefix := fmt.Sprintf("%x ", table) | ||||
| 	err = b.db.View(func(tx *buntdb.Tx) error { | ||||
| 		err := tx.AscendGreaterOrEqual("", tablePrefix, func(key, value string) bool { | ||||
| 			if !strings.HasPrefix(key, tablePrefix) { | ||||
| 				return false | ||||
| 			} | ||||
| 			uuid, err := utils.DecodeUUID(strings.TrimPrefix(key, tablePrefix)) | ||||
| 			if err == nil { | ||||
| 				result = append(result, datastore.KV{UUID: uuid, Value: []byte(value)}) | ||||
| 			} else { | ||||
| 				b.logger.Error("datastore", "invalid uuid", key) | ||||
| 			} | ||||
| 			return true | ||||
| 		}) | ||||
| 		return err | ||||
| 	}) | ||||
| 	return | ||||
| } | ||||
| 
 | ||||
| func (b *buntdbDatastore) Get(table datastore.Table, uuid utils.UUID) (value []byte, err error) { | ||||
| 	buntKey := BuntKey(table, uuid) | ||||
| 	var result string | ||||
| 	err = b.db.View(func(tx *buntdb.Tx) error { | ||||
| 		result, err = tx.Get(buntKey) | ||||
| 		return err | ||||
| 	}) | ||||
| 	return []byte(result), err | ||||
| } | ||||
| 
 | ||||
| func (b *buntdbDatastore) Set(table datastore.Table, uuid utils.UUID, value []byte, expiration time.Time) (err error) { | ||||
| 	buntKey := BuntKey(table, uuid) | ||||
| 	var setOptions *buntdb.SetOptions | ||||
| 	if !expiration.IsZero() { | ||||
| 		ttl := time.Until(expiration) | ||||
| 		if ttl > 0 { | ||||
| 			setOptions = &buntdb.SetOptions{Expires: true, TTL: ttl} | ||||
| 		} else { | ||||
| 			return nil // it already expired, i guess? | ||||
| 		} | ||||
| 	} | ||||
| 	strVal := string(value) | ||||
| 
 | ||||
| 	err = b.db.Update(func(tx *buntdb.Tx) error { | ||||
| 		_, _, err := tx.Set(buntKey, strVal, setOptions) | ||||
| 		return err | ||||
| 	}) | ||||
| 	return | ||||
| } | ||||
| 
 | ||||
| func (b *buntdbDatastore) Delete(table datastore.Table, key utils.UUID) (err error) { | ||||
| 	buntKey := BuntKey(table, key) | ||||
| 	err = b.db.Update(func(tx *buntdb.Tx) error { | ||||
| 		_, err := tx.Delete(buntKey) | ||||
| 		return err | ||||
| 	}) | ||||
| 	// deleting a nonexistent key is not considered an error | ||||
| 	switch err { | ||||
| 	case buntdb.ErrNotFound: | ||||
| 		return nil | ||||
| 	default: | ||||
| 		return err | ||||
| 	} | ||||
| } | ||||

							| @ -0,0 +1,45 @@ | ||||
| // Copyright (c) 2022 Shivaram Lingamneni <slingamn@cs.stanford.edu> | ||||
| // released under the MIT license | ||||
| 
 | ||||
| package datastore | ||||
| 
 | ||||
| import ( | ||||
| 	"time" | ||||
| 
 | ||||
| 	"github.com/ergochat/ergo/irc/utils" | ||||
| ) | ||||
| 
 | ||||
| type Table uint16 | ||||
| 
 | ||||
| // XXX these are persisted and must remain stable; | ||||
| // do not reorder, when deleting use _ to ensure that the deleted value is skipped | ||||
| const ( | ||||
| 	TableMetadata Table = iota | ||||
| 	TableChannels | ||||
| 	TableChannelPurges | ||||
| ) | ||||
| 
 | ||||
| type KV struct { | ||||
| 	UUID  utils.UUID | ||||
| 	Value []byte | ||||
| } | ||||
| 
 | ||||
| // A Datastore provides the following abstraction: | ||||
| // 1. Tables, each keyed on a UUID (the implementation is free to merge | ||||
| // the table name and the UUID into a single key as long as the rest of | ||||
| // the contract can be satisfied). Table names are [a-z0-9_]+ | ||||
| // 2. The ability to efficiently enumerate all uuid-value pairs in a table | ||||
| // 3. Gets, sets, and deletes for individual (table, uuid) keys | ||||
| type Datastore interface { | ||||
| 	Backoff() time.Duration | ||||
| 
 | ||||
| 	GetAll(table Table) ([]KV, error) | ||||
| 
 | ||||
| 	// This is rarely used because it would typically lead to TOCTOU races | ||||
| 	Get(table Table, key utils.UUID) (value []byte, err error) | ||||
| 
 | ||||
| 	Set(table Table, key utils.UUID, value []byte, expiration time.Time) error | ||||
| 
 | ||||
| 	// Note that deleting a nonexistent key is not considered an error | ||||
| 	Delete(table Table, key utils.UUID) error | ||||
| } | ||||

							| @ -0,0 +1,56 @@ | ||||
| // Copyright (c) 2022 Shivaram Lingamneni <slingamn@cs.stanford.edu> | ||||
| // released under the MIT license | ||||
| 
 | ||||
| package utils | ||||
| 
 | ||||
| import ( | ||||
| 	"crypto/rand" | ||||
| 	"encoding/base64" | ||||
| 	"errors" | ||||
| ) | ||||
| 
 | ||||
| var ( | ||||
| 	ErrInvalidUUID = errors.New("Invalid uuid") | ||||
| ) | ||||
| 
 | ||||
| // Technically a UUIDv4 has version bits set, but this doesn't matter in practice | ||||
| type UUID [16]byte | ||||
| 
 | ||||
| func (u UUID) MarshalJSON() (b []byte, err error) { | ||||
| 	b = make([]byte, 24) | ||||
| 	b[0] = '"' | ||||
| 	base64.RawURLEncoding.Encode(b[1:], u[:]) | ||||
| 	b[23] = '"' | ||||
| 	return | ||||
| } | ||||
| 
 | ||||
| func (u *UUID) UnmarshalJSON(b []byte) (err error) { | ||||
| 	if len(b) != 24 { | ||||
| 		return ErrInvalidUUID | ||||
| 	} | ||||
| 	readLen, err := base64.RawURLEncoding.Decode(u[:], b[1:23]) | ||||
| 	if readLen != 16 { | ||||
| 		return ErrInvalidUUID | ||||
| 	} | ||||
| 	return nil | ||||
| } | ||||
| 
 | ||||
| func (u *UUID) String() string { | ||||
| 	return base64.RawURLEncoding.EncodeToString(u[:]) | ||||
| } | ||||
| 
 | ||||
| func GenerateUUIDv4() (result UUID) { | ||||
| 	_, err := rand.Read(result[:]) | ||||
| 	if err != nil { | ||||
| 		panic(err) | ||||
| 	} | ||||
| 	return | ||||
| } | ||||
| 
 | ||||
| func DecodeUUID(ustr string) (result UUID, err error) { | ||||
| 	length, err := base64.RawURLEncoding.Decode(result[:], []byte(ustr)) | ||||
| 	if err == nil && length != 16 { | ||||
| 		err = ErrInvalidUUID | ||||
| 	} | ||||
| 	return | ||||
| } | ||||
